Background on This Chat Topic

Do you see optimism as something positive? Do your work colleagues, friends, and family agree with you? You might think this is a ridiculous question yet there are varying views on optimism. It affects interactions and thus worthwhile to explore.

Some people dislike being around optimists. They see them as dreamers who quietly demand that others smile and be happy.

Others love them. They see optimists as inspirational thinkers who sustain others with hope as they work to make things better. Phew .. what a large gap in definition and perception! So let’s explore optimism and see if we can close the gap.

As we think ahead to Sunday’s people skills chat, questions come to mind:

  • Why does this gap exist? Pessimists, optimists, realists?
  • What is your definition of optimism?
  • How does optimism and inspiration relate or differ?
  • If you had to choose between being around optimists or non-optimists, which would you choose and why?
  • How does optimism make you feel?
  • How does optimism influence outcomes?
  • What effect does optimism have on people skills?
